How do I set up timer for sheet?
The following is a simple example of a timer with the Start Timer and Stop
Timer subs. Custom format the cell to display the time so that it includes the date and the time including seconds. Example for regional date displayed in D/M/Y format. d mmm yyyy h:mm:ss 'RunWhen must be declared at top of 'a standard Module before any subs Public RunWhen As Date Sub StartTimer() Dim TimerIntervals TimerIntervals = 1 'In seconds RunWhen = Now + _ TimeSerial(0, 0, TimerIntervals) ActiveSheet.Range("A1") = Now Application.OnTime _ EarliestTime:=RunWhen, _ Procedu="StartTimer", _ Schedule:=True End Sub Sub StopTimer() 'On Error required in case timer already stopped 'RunWhen must be same value that started timer On Error Resume Next Application.OnTime _ EarliestTime:=RunWhen, _ Procedu="StartTimer", _ Schedule:=False End Sub -- Regards, OssieMac "ruhan" wrote: How do I set up timer for sheet? |
